Vai al contenuto principale
HomePython

Corso

Introduzione al Natural Language Processing in Python

IntermedioLivello di competenza
Aggiornato 02/2026
Impara le tecniche di base per lavorare con il linguaggio naturale usando Python e come usarle per capire meglio i dati testuali del mondo reale.
Inizia il corso gratis
PythonMachine Learning
4 h
15 video
51 Esercizi
3,750 XP
140K+
Attestato di conseguimento

Crea il tuo account gratuito

Continua con GoogleMostra più opzioni

o


Continuando, accetti i nostri Termini di utilizzo, la nostra Informativa sulla privacy e che i tuoi dati siano conservati negli Stati Uniti.

Preferito dagli studenti di migliaia di aziende

Group

Formare un team?

Prova per il Business

Descrizione del corso

In questo corso imparerai le basi del Natural Language Processing (NLP), ad esempio come identificare e separare le parole, come estrarre gli argomenti da un testo e come costruire un tuo classificatore di fake news. Imparerai anche a usare librerie di base come NLTK, insieme a librerie che sfruttano il deep learning per risolvere problemi NLP comuni. Questo corso ti fornirà le basi per elaborare e analizzare testi mentre prosegui con l’apprendimento di Python.

Prerequisiti

Python Toolbox
1

Espressioni regolari e tokenizzazione delle parole

Questo capitolo introduce alcuni concetti fondamentali di NLP, come la tokenizzazione delle parole e le espressioni regolari per aiutarti ad analizzare il testo. Imparerai anche a gestire testi non in inglese e casi di tokenizzazione più complessi che potresti incontrare.
Inizia il capitolo
2

Identificazione semplice degli argomenti

Questo capitolo ti introdurrà all’identificazione degli argomenti, che puoi applicare a qualsiasi testo reale. Usando modelli NLP di base, identificherai gli argomenti nei testi in base alla frequenza dei termini. Sperimenterai e confronterai due metodi semplici: bag-of-words e Tf-idf con NLTK e una nuova libreria, Gensim.
Inizia il capitolo
3

Riconoscimento di entità nominate

Questo capitolo affronterà un argomento un po’ più avanzato: il riconoscimento di entità nominate. Imparerai a identificare il chi, cosa e dove dei tuoi testi usando modelli pre-addestrati su testi in inglese e non. Imparerai anche a usare nuove librerie, polyglot e spaCy, per arricchire la tua cassetta degli attrezzi NLP.
Inizia il capitolo
Introduzione al Natural Language Processing in Python
Corso
completato

Ottieni Attestato di conseguimento

Aggiungi questa certificazione al tuo profilo LinkedIn, al curriculum o al CV
Condividila sui social e nella valutazione delle tue performance
Iscriviti ora

Unisciti a oltre 19 milioni di studenti e inizia Introduzione al Natural Language Processing in Python oggi!

Crea il tuo account gratuito

Continua con GoogleMostra più opzioni

o


Continuando, accetti i nostri Termini di utilizzo, la nostra Informativa sulla privacy e che i tuoi dati siano conservati negli Stati Uniti.

Aumenta le tue competenze sui dati con l'app di DataCamp

Avanza ovunque ti trovi con i nostri corsi per dispositivi mobili e le nostre sfide di programmazione quotidiane da 5 minuti.